Watching others successfully change their behavior can give you ideas and encouragement for your own changes. This is the process of modeling or learning from others, and it can be very helpful when preparing for a behavior change.
Learning from other people’s behaviors can be greatly beneficial since observers are able to see the change and its effects to the people who possesses these behaviors.

The belief-desire psychology which also known as folk psychology means the idea is that simple people understand other simple people in terms of the hypothesis or expectation that another peoples’ action and performance is the outcome of their cognitive insides which is their psychology. The beliefs and desires communicate and cooperate each other to construct intentions and these intentions can lead to actions. This is a kind of folk-theory of human behavior.
The legal
right to expatriation means that you have the right to renounce your
citizenship.
An expatriate (often shortened to expat) is a person
temporarily or permanently residing, as an immigrant, in a country other than
that of their citizenship. The word comes from the Latin terms ex ("out
of") and patria ("country, fatherland").

The paper money or currency in the united states essentially represents a debt of the Federal Reserve System.
The official currency of the United States and several other nations is the United States dollar (symbol: $; code: USD). The Coinage Act of 1792 established the United States dollar on par with the Spanish silver dollar, divided it into 100 cents, and permitted the minting of coins with dollar and cent values. Federal Reserve Notes, which are commonly referred to as "greenbacks" due to their predominately green tint, are the type of U.S. banknotes that are issued. The Federal Reserve System, which serves as the country's central bank, manages the monetary policy of the United States.
